Payments relative to costs vary greatly among hospitals depending on the mix of payers. Medicare and Medicaid pay less than cost, the uninsured pay little or nothing, and others must make up the difference. An annual exam with your primary care physician is an example of outpatient care, but so are emergent cases where the patient leaves the emergency department the same day they arrive. Additionally, when a patient presents for a minor surgical procedure, or other treatment that is expected to keep them in the hospital for only a few hours (less than 24), they are considered outpatients, regardless of the hour the patient presented to the hospital and if that patient remained in the facility over the midnight census. The policy reduces the number of visitors/support persons . Care is either provided for free, or based wholly or partly on Medicare rates under the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) regulations. While there are government programs such as Medicare and Medicaid disproportionate hospital payments designed to help hospitals with the cost of treating low-income and uninsured patients, it is not enough to cover the cost of care.
